When evaluating indoor storage facilities in the Espanola area, prioritize climate-controlled units. While our winters are relatively mild, summer heat can exceed 90°F, and winter nights can dip below freezing. A stable, climate-controlled environment prevents gel coat cracking, wood drying, and moisture-related mildew—common issues in our arid yet variable weather. Look for facilities that offer more than just four walls and a roof. Good security features like gated access, surveillance cameras, and individual unit alarms provide peace of mind, especially for longer-term storage during the off-season.
Consider the logistics specific to our region. Many storage facilities in the Rio Grande Valley are designed with boat owners in mind, offering ample maneuvering space for trailers. Before committing, measure your boat and trailer's total length, including the motor, to ensure a proper fit. It's also wise to inquire about drive-up access or ground-floor units to simplify the loading and unloading process. Some local facilities even provide power outlets in units, allowing you to maintain your boat's battery with a trickle charger—a small but valuable perk.
Preparation is key before storing your boat indoors. Given our low humidity, it's essential to thoroughly clean and dry your boat to prevent any residual moisture from causing issues. A comprehensive winterization process is still recommended, even with indoor storage, as freezing nights can occur. This includes stabilizing fuel, fogging the engine, and draining water systems.
